XC9802B463ER-G Description
The XC9802B463ER-G is a high-performance boost converter IC designed by Torex Semiconductor Ltd., a leading manufacturer in the power management integrated circuits (PMIC) domain. This device is part of the XC9802 series and is specifically engineered to deliver a fixed output voltage of 4.6V with a maximum output current of 80mA. The IC operates within a wide input voltage range, from a minimum of 1.8V to a maximum of 5.5V, making it highly versatile for various power supply applications.
The XC9802B463ER-G features a switching frequency of 300kHz, which ensures efficient power conversion and minimal electromagnetic interference (EMI). It employs a boost topology, which is ideal for applications requiring a higher output voltage than the input voltage. The device is packaged in a surface-mount USP-8B05 format, which is suitable for compact and space-constrained designs. Additionally, the XC9802B463ER-G is REACH unaffected and RoHS3 compliant, ensuring environmental sustainability and regulatory compliance.
XC9802B463ER-G Features
- Fixed Output Voltage: The XC9802B463ER-G provides a stable output voltage of 4.6V, ensuring consistent power delivery to connected devices.
- Wide Input Voltage Range: With an input voltage range of 1.8V to 5.5V, this IC can accommodate a variety of power sources, enhancing its flexibility and usability.
- High Efficiency: The 300kHz switching frequency allows for high-efficiency power conversion, reducing energy loss and improving overall system performance.
- Compact Design: The surface-mount USP-8B05 package is ideal for applications where space is a critical factor, enabling the integration of the IC into compact electronic devices.
- Environmental Compliance: The XC9802B463ER-G is REACH unaffected and RoHS3 compliant, making it suitable for environmentally conscious designs and meeting global regulatory standards.
- Moisture Sensitivity Level: With an MSL of 1 (Unlimited), the IC is highly resistant to moisture, ensuring reliability in various environmental conditions.
